'I am a fan'- 2016 Olympic Games top scorer reveals what makes Super Eagles striker Boniface so special
Published: October 16, 2024
2016 Olympic Games top scorer with six goals in six matches, Nils Petersen has admitted that he is a fan of Bayer Leverkusen center forward Victor Boniface.
After putting himself in the shop window by scoring against Bayer Leverkusen in the quarterfinals of the 2022-2023 Europa League, the Black and Reds acquired Boniface from Belgian outfit Royale Union Saint-Gilloise in the summer of 2023 for a fee of 21.7 million euros.
The Real Saphire alumni has made a splash since arriving in Germany, playing a key role as Bayer Leverkusen won the Bundesliga and DFB-Pokal.
Despite an injury he sustained while on international duty with the Super Eagles that kept him sidelined for around three months, he finished his first season at Bayer Leverkusen with spectacular figures, registering 31 goal involvements (21 goals, 10 assists) in thirty-four appearances, proving that he is an offensive all-rounder.
Only Eintracht Frankfurt's Omar Marmoush (8), Bayern Munich's Harry Kane (5), VfB Stuttgart's Ermedin Demirović (5) and FSV Mainz's Jonathan Burkardt (5) have scored more goals than Boniface (4) in the new Bundesliga season.
Nils Petersen believes that the Bayer Leverkusen star has all the qualities necessary to make a name for himself in the Bundesliga and expects him to score many more goals by the end of the season.
"I have to say that I am a fan of Victor Boniface. As an opponent, you just don't want to play against him," he told fussball.news.
When asked to reveal what makes Boniface so special, Petersen replied: "He hurts, he's fast, he can go one-on-one, he can score goals. He has everything."
Nils Petersen scored against Nigeria in the semifinals of the 2016 Olympic Games.
